Virginia Veterans Care Center is one of the top-rated nursing facilities in Roanoke, Virginia, earning an A grade based on CMS data. With a score of 92/100, it ranks in the top 7% of facilities statewide — a strong indicator of quality care.
Staffing at Virginia Veterans Care Center is near the national average, with 3.70 total nursing hours per resident per day (national average: 3.8 hours).
Recent inspections identified 16 deficiencies at Virginia Veterans Care Center. While none were classified as the most serious level, families should review the detailed inspection history below.

🏥 Staffing Details
| Staff Type | Hours/Resident/Day | National Avg | Comparison |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Nursing | 3.70 | 3.8 | Average |
| Registered Nurses (RN) | 0.71 | 0.7 | Average |
|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) | 0.74 | 0.7 | Average |
|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A) | 2.25 | 2.4 | Average |
| Weekend Total Nursing | 3.10 | 3.8 | Below Average |
| Weekend RN Hours | 0.39 | 0.7 | Below Average |

📊 Resident Outcome Measures
Based on CMS quality measure data. Lower percentages are better for most metrics.
| Measure | This Facility | Nat'l Avg |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Residents with pressure ulcers | 1.4% | 4.5% | Better |
| Falls with major injury | 3.0% | 3.0% | Average |
| On antipsychotic medication | 27.4% | 14.5% | Worse |
| Urinary tract infections | 2.5% | 2.5% | Average |
| ADL decline (daily activities) | 17.7% | 14.0% | Worse |
| Excessive weight loss | 5.9% | 7.5% | Better |
| New/worsened incontinence | 28.2% | 45.0% | Better |
How This Grade Was Calculated
This facility's grade of A is based on a score of 92 out of 100, calculated from official CMS Nursing Home Compare data:
- Overall CMS Rating: 5★ → 40 pts (max 40)
- Health Inspection Rating: 5★ → 25 pts (max 25)
- Staffing Rating: 3★ → 12 pts (max 20)
- Quality Measures Rating: 5★ → 15 pts (max 15)
Grades: A=85+, B=70–84, C=55–69, D=40–54, F=below 40
